Playing on:
13843 views
Sand Castle
Set during the occupation of Iraq, a squad of U.S. soldiers try to protect a small village.
Actors: Henry Cavill / Nicholas Hoult / Glen Powell / Tommy Flanagan / Logan Marshall-Green / Beau Knapp / Neil Brown Jr. / Sam Spruell / Navid Negahban / Gonzalo Menendez / Ziad Abaza / Sammy Sheik / Sope Dirisu / Nabil Elouahabi / Osy Ikhile